Alina Zagitova

 Alina Ilnazovna Zagitova (Russian: Alina Il'nazovna Zagitova, IPA: [a'ljin@ za'gjit@v@]; born 18 May 2002) is a Russian figure skater. She was the 2018 Olympic champion as well as the 2019 World champion as well as the 2018 European champion, the 2017-18 Grand Prix Final champion, and the 2018 Russian national champion. Zagitova also earned an Olympic silver medal in the team event of the 2018 Winter Olympics, representing the Olympic Athletes from Russia team.Zagitova is the sole Russian female figure skater to have won gold at the Olympic Games, World Figure Skating Championships, European Figure Skating Championships and Grand Prix of Figure Skating Final. Zagitova is the only Muslim to earn an Olympic figure-skating gold medal, an award that is the most prestigious in the world, and also the Super Slam. She is the youngest and the second women's singles skater following Yuna Kim, to win gold in every major ISU championships, including the Junior Grand Prix Series and Final, World Junior Championships, Grand Prix Series and Final, European Championships, World Championships, and Winter Olympic Games. She took home the gold medal earlier in her career, at the 2017 World Junior Championships as well in the 2016-17 Junior Grand Prix Final. At the 2016-17 Junior Grand Prix Final, she became the first junior lady to reach a total score above 200 mark.Zagitova has broken the world record once in the old system and four times with the new system.
